Estudantes Sport Club, also known as Estudantes, are a Brazilian football team from Timbaúba, Pernambuco. They competed in the Série B in 1991, and in the Série C in 1990.

Estudantes Sport Club were founded on May 1, 1958.[1] The club competed in the Série C in 1990, when they were eliminated in the first stage.[2] They competed in the Série B in 1991, when they were eliminated in the first stage of the competition.[3] Estudantes won the Campeonato Pernambucano Second Level in 2005.[4]
